In the morning, our driver will pick you up from your Guilin hotel. They’ll take you straight to the dock in a cool, air-conditioned vehicle, which takes 1 hour to get to the dock. The driver will redeem the physical ticket for you at the dock. Once you get on the cruise boat, get ready for something amazing. The Li River will look like a real-life Chinese painting. Watch local fishermen on bamboo rafts, calling their big black cormorant birds to catch fish—it’s a super old way of fishing, and you’ll see it up close.
